计算科学专业涵盖多个方向,不同领域具有不同优势和发展前景。以下是综合多个权威来源的推荐方向及学习重点:
人工智能(AI)
机器学习、深度学习、自然语言处理等前沿技术,适合对智能系统感兴趣的学生。
推荐课程:《机器学习》《深度学习》《自然语言处理》。
软件工程
覆盖软件设计、开发、测试及维护全流程,市场需求大且就业前景广阔。
核心课程:《软件工程导论》《数据结构与算法》《操作系统》。
数据科学
通过统计分析、机器学习将数据转化为决策支持,适合数学基础较好者。
推荐课程:《数据挖掘》《统计学习方法》《Python数据分析》。
网络工程与信息安全
网络架构设计、网络安全防护,随着数字化发展需求持续增长。
核心课程:《计算机网络》《网络安全原理》《密码学》。
信息与计算科学 :数学分析、高等代数、概率论等,适合数学基础扎实者,可向科研或高端技术岗位发展。
算法与数据结构 :掌握高效算法设计及数据存储优化,是计算机科学的核心能力。
计算机图形学与可视化 :应用于游戏开发、影视特效等,需结合数学建模与编程技能。
智能建筑与物联网 :结合计算机技术、自动控制及建筑管理,培养综合性工程人才。
移动计算与边缘计算 :关注移动设备与嵌入式系统的开发,适应物联网时代需求。
考研方向 :计算机科学与技术、软件工程、信息与计算科学等专业报考热度较高。
职业规划 :AI/数据科学适合技术型,软件工程适合系统开发,网络安全需结合编程与合规知识。
通常包含数学分析、算法设计、数据结构、操作系统、编程语言(如Python/C++)、数据库系统等基础课程,以及领域专项课程(如人工智能、网络安全等)。
总结 :选择方向时需结合兴趣、职业规划及自身数学基础。人工智能、软件工程、数据科学是当前最具活力和就业保障的领域,而数学与理论基础则为深入研究提供支撑。